These contests provided ample opportunity to demonstrate the superiority of alternative keyboard arrangements. That Qwerty survived significant challenges early in the history of typewriting demonstrates that it is at least among the reasonably fit, even if not the fittest that can be imagined.
Famous Fables of Economics, Chapter 4: Fable of the Keys (book) by Stan J. Liebowitz and Stephen E. Margolis (see stats)
